Abstract
A scalp care solution based on crocus sativus and a preparation method thereof relate to the technical field of scalp care, and the scalp care solution comprises the following components in percentage by mass: extracting crocus sativus to obtain pure dew: 81.27-91.52%, disodium EDTA: 0.01-0.03%, butanediol: 4-5%, p-hydroxyacetophenone: 0.1-0.3%, 1, 2-pentanediol: 0.1-1%, hydroxyphenylpropionamide benzoic acid: 0.5-2%, tromethamine: 0.01-0.1%, deionized water: 2-5%, caprylyl hydroxamic acid: 0.05-0.4%, glyceryl caprylate: 0.05-0.4%, methyl propylene glycol: 0.05-0.4%, lactobacillus/soy milk fermentation product filtrate: 0.5-1%, the saffron component in the invention is matched with other components for relieving scalp in the nursing liquid, so that the scalp environment is better improved, the problem that the scalp environment balance is damaged is radically solved, and the hair growth is better facilitated.

Disclosure of Invention
Aiming at the defects in the prior art, one of the purposes of the invention is to provide a scalp care solution based on crocus sativus, and the specific scheme is as follows:
a scalp care solution based on crocus sativus comprises the following components in parts by mass:
extracting crocus sativus to obtain pure dew: 81.27-91.52%
Disodium EDTA: 0.01 to 0.03 percent
Butanediol: 4 to 5 percent
P-hydroxyacetophenone: 0.1 to 0.3 percent
1, 2-pentanediol: 0.1 to 1 percent
Hydroxyphenylpropionamide benzoic acid: 0.5 to 2 percent
Tromethamine: 0.01 to 0.1 percent
Deionized water: 2 to 5 percent
Caprylyl hydroximic acid: 0.05-0.4%
Glyceryl caprylate: 0.05-0.4%
Methyl propylene glycol: 0.05-0.4%
Lactobacillus/soy milk fermentation product filtrate: 0.5 to 1 percent.
Further, the care solution also comprises 1-2% of polysorbate-20 and 0.01-0.1% of saffron oil.
Furthermore, the care solution also comprises 0.1-1% of hydrolyzed olive leaf extract.
The invention also aims to provide a preparation method of the scalp care solution, which comprises the following specific scheme:
a preparation method of a scalp care solution comprises the following steps:
s1: stirring and dissolving tromethamine with deionized water in advance for later use;
s2: heating crocus sativus oil with polysorbate-20 in a container to 48-52 deg.C, stirring and pre-dissolving;
s3: sequentially adding crocus sativus extract hydrosol, EDTA disodium, butanediol and p-hydroxyacetophenone into a reaction pot, stirring at the stirring speed of 110-;
s4: after the materials are completely dissolved in a reaction pot in S3, cooling to 45 ℃, sequentially adding 1, 2-pentanediol, hydroxyphenylpropionamide benzoic acid, pre-dissolved tromethamine in S1, caprylyl hydroxamic acid, glyceryl caprylate, methyl propanediol, lactobacillus/soybean milk fermentation product filtrate, pre-dissolved polysorbate-20 in S2, saffron oil and hydrolyzed olive leaf extract, and stirring at the speed of 180 revolutions per minute until the materials are completely dissolved;
s5: discharging after the inspection is qualified for later use.
Further, the extraction process of the crocus sativus extract hydrosol is as follows:
the crocus sativus and water are respectively placed in a first heating container and a second heating container, water vapor generated after the water is boiled enters from the lower part of the second heating container and goes out from the upper part of the second heating container, the crocus sativus is heated for 4-5 hours, the water vapor carrying crocus sativus components passes through a condenser and then enters a layered extractor to be gradually separated into an upper layer and a lower layer, and the lower layer of the layered extractor can release crocus sativus extract hydrosol.
Furthermore, the ratio of the crocus sativus to the water is 1 (1-1.5).
Compared with the prior art, the invention has the following beneficial effects:
the scalp care solution disclosed by the invention is used for the scalp, saffron-extracted hydrolat is used as a main base material, the content is high, water is not added basically, deionized water is only used as a solvent of tromethamine, the concentration of saffron components is hardly influenced by the deionized water, the effect of the saffron is fully exerted, the scalp blood circulation is promoted, the antioxidant capacity and the antifungal capacity of the scalp care solution are exerted, other scalp-soothing components in the care solution are combined, the scalp environment is better improved, the problem that the scalp environment balance is damaged is solved fundamentally, and the growth of the hair is facilitated.
Specifically, the crocus sativus extract hydrosol, the crocus sativus oil are used as main skin conditioners, the hydroxyphenyl propionamide benzoic acid and lactobacillus/soybean milk fermentation product filtrate are used as auxiliary skin conditioners, the p-hydroxyacetophenone is used as an antioxidant, the butanediol and the 1, 2-pentanediol are combined to be used as a humectant, the glyceryl caprylate is used as a softener, when the scalp care solution acts on the scalp, the scalp care solution is mild and has small stimulation, the scalp blood circulation is promoted, the scalp can be relieved by combining a massage method, and the scalp can be sterilized, so that the possibility of scalp itching is relieved. For review, the present invention uses saffron as the main ingredient, and combines with a plurality of other soothing ingredients to jointly exert the efficacy in scalp care.
According to the invention, the crocus sativus component is mainly crocus sativus extract hydrosol, the crocus sativus extract hydrosol is not required to be directly soaked in water in the extracting mode, the defects that aromatic components are damaged and aromatic substances are wasted by a water body when water and crocus sativus are integrally mixed for distillation are avoided in the extracting mode, the ratio of the crocus sativus to the water is close, the prepared crocus sativus extract hydrosol is high in purity, the efficacy of the finally obtained scalp care solution is enhanced, and the effect is quick.

In examples 1-3, saffron extract hydrosol was used as a skin conditioner, disodium EDTA was used as a chelating agent, butylene glycol was used as a humectant, p-hydroxyacetophenone was used as an antioxidant, 1, 2-pentanediol was used as a humectant, hydroxyphenylpropionamide benzoic acid was used as a skin conditioner, tromethamine was used as a pH adjuster, deionized water was used as a solvent, caprylyl hydroxamic acid was used as a chelating agent, glyceryl caprylate was used as a softener, methyl propylene glycol was used as a solvent, lactobacillus/soybean milk fermentation product filtrate was used as a skin conditioner, polysorbate-20 was used as an emulsifier, saffron oil was used as a skin conditioner, and hydrolyzed olive leaf extract was used as a skin conditioner.
The crocus sativus extract hydrosol and crocus sativus oil can promote scalp blood circulation, and also have antioxidant and antifungal effects, and hydroxyphenyl propionamide benzoic acid can resist histamine, irritation and itching. Can effectively inhibit skin erythema, edema and pruritus caused by histamine. Can buffer the sensitizing substances. The hydrolyzed olive leaf extract has the effects of diminishing inflammation, relieving and resisting allergy, whitening and removing freckles, and is suitable for 8 types of skin, namely oily skin, tolerant skin, non-pigmented skin, dry skin, wrinkled skin, sensitive skin, pigmented skin and compact skin. The combined action improves the scalp environment, and radically solves the problem that the scalp environment is damaged in a balanced way.
Aiming at the embodiments 1-3, the invention is also provided with a preparation method of the scalp care solution, and the preparation method comprises the following steps:
s1: stirring and dissolving tromethamine with deionized water in advance for later use;
s2: heating crocus sativus oil with polysorbate-20 in a container to 50 deg.C, stirring and pre-dissolving;
s3: sequentially adding crocus sativus extract hydrosol, EDTA disodium, butanediol and p-hydroxyacetophenone into a reaction pot, stirring at the stirring speed of 110-;
s4: after the materials are completely dissolved in a reaction pot in S3, cooling to 45 ℃, sequentially adding 1, 2-pentanediol, hydroxyphenylpropionamide benzoic acid, pre-dissolved tromethamine in S1, caprylyl hydroxamic acid, glyceryl caprylate, methyl propanediol, lactobacillus/soybean milk fermentation product filtrate, pre-dissolved polysorbate-20 in S2, saffron oil and a hydrolyzed olive leaf extract, and stirring at the speed of 200 r/min until the materials are completely dissolved;
s5: discharging after the inspection is qualified for later use.
In detail, the extraction process of the crocus sativus extract hydrosol is as follows:
the crocus sativus and water are respectively placed in a first heating container and a second heating container, the ratio of the crocus sativus to the water is 1 (1-1.5), the specific ratio is determined according to actual operation, water vapor generated after the water is boiled enters and exits from the second heating container, the crocus sativus is heated for 4-5 hours, the water vapor carrying crocus sativus components passes through a condenser and then enters a layered extractor to be gradually separated into an upper layer and a lower layer, and the lower layer of the layered extractor can release crocus sativus extract hydrolat.
First heating container can adopt the round flask, is convenient for be heated evenly, and the second heating container can adopt cylindrical storage tank, and the intercommunication is provided with the glass pipe between the top of first heating container and second heating container's the bottom, and the lateral wall and the condenser intercommunication of second heating container, the export of condenser are directly over the import funnel of layering extractor, and the intercommunication is provided with the outlet pipe on the lateral wall that layering extractor is close to the bottom.
In the Chinese invention with the publication number of CN110051608A, the saffron extract is prepared by physical crushing treatment and then is treated according to the proportion of 1: 45, the effective saffron ingredients in the finally obtained saffron extract are mixed with each other, compared with the Chinese invention with the publication number of CN110051608A, the method for extracting the saffron hydrolat is less difficult to operate, the ratio of the saffron to water is close to that of the saffron in the method for extracting the hydrosol, the saffron does not need to be soaked in the solution, the physical damage to the saffron is not needed, the possibility of damaging the aromatic ingredients and wasting the aromatic substances is greatly reduced compared with the traditional distillation method, and the purity of the prepared saffron extract hydrolat is higher.
In addition, the extraction process of the crocus sativus extract hydrosol can also be as follows:
loading the selected high-quality saffron into a tray, placing the tray into a freeze-drying bin in a freeze dryer, carrying out freeze-drying dehydration, wherein the temperature of the freeze-drying bin is lower than 60 ℃, carrying out condensation crystallization on steam containing saffron liquid generated by evaporation in the drying process, continuously washing ice crystals formed by steam crystallization by using the saffron liquid with the temperature of 50-60 ℃, mixing the melted ice crystals into the saffron liquid, collecting, storing and circularly washing the ice crystals to finally obtain the crocus sativus extract hydrolat. Compared with the Chinese invention with the publication number of CN110051608A, the extraction method does not need to use extra solvent to react with the saffron and does not need to physically damage the saffron, and the saffron extract in the saffron extract can be collected and extracted without a high-temperature environment, thereby protecting the nutrient components in the saffron extract.
And (3) effect testing: the scalp care solutions finally obtained by the preparation methods of examples 1 to 3 and comparative example 1 were used clinically.
Selecting 120 experimenters, the age is 25-45 years, wherein 60 male patients and 60 female patients are averagely divided into 4 groups, each group comprises 30 male patients and 15 female patients, wherein each group of experimenters respectively uses the scalp care solution in the embodiments 1-3 and the anti-hair loss hair-nourishing spray essence in the comparative example 1, the scalp care solution and the anti-hair loss hair-nourishing spray essence are respectively arranged in a bottle body with an atomizing nozzle, the scalp care solution and the anti-hair loss hair-nourishing spray essence are directly sprayed on the scalp and the hair, the scalp and the hair are gently massaged for 5-10 minutes, the application is continuously carried out for 1 time every day, the days are recorded, after one week, the experimenters are subjected to scalp and hair follicle detection every other week, the total record is 2 weeks, and the dandruff degree, the head itching interval days and the oil. The test results are shown in the following tables.
